Output 30001210406c66e66d25f99a74c1b42cad543a13b81b94cea3a08dfa0042926b:1

value
495705
script pubkey
OP_0 OP_PUSHBYTES_20 ac7573ba02620a15865a530a7b7351aa55afd0b3
address
bc1q436h8wszvg9ptpj62v98ku634f26l59nyagjlr
transaction
30001210406c66e66d25f99a74c1b42cad543a13b81b94cea3a08dfa0042926b
spent
true